Re: What % Of Your Salary Pays Your Rent? by Ephort: 11:25am On Apr 11, 2018 |
Lastanza: Is it not better to use percentage of the income left after removing all recurrent expenses like feeding, transport, home running, etc. This is because you pay your rent from what is left after those expenses. Some people's rent could be 10% of their salary and 70% of their take-home after the above is factored. |
